UnicodeDecodeError: 'gbk' codec can't decode byte 0xb7 in position 20: illegal multibyte sequence
时间: 2023-11-15 07:02:08 浏览: 57
pyquery报错:UnicodeDecodeError: ‘gbk’ codec can’t decode byte
5星 · 资源好评率100%
这个错误通常是因为Python在读取文件时使用了错误的编码方式。在这种情况下,Python试图使用GBK编码方式读取文件,但是文件中包含了无法被GBK编码方式解析的字符,导致出现了错误。解决这个问题的方法是将文件的编码方式改为正确的编码方式,例如UTF-8。可以在打开文件时指定正确的编码方式,例如使用with open(file, 'r', encoding='utf-8') as f:来打开文件。
阅读全文